Monday Morning Data Chat ranks #5247 on The B2B Podcast Index with a substance score of 45.0 out of 100, scored across 1 recent episode. It scores highest on guest caliber and specificity & evidence. The two hosts (Joe Reis and Matt Housley) are legitimate practitioners - data engineering consultants and O'Reilly authors with real field experience - which raises the floor. However, every guest who actually appears in this episode is a community member, friend, or minor industry figure dropping in to say goodbye, with no substantive expertise on display.
Averaged across 1 recently scored episode, with cited evidence.
This is almost entirely a farewell/nostalgia episode with guest cameos, personal anecdotes, and social chatter. The few substantive moments - on Hadoop economics, classical NLP hybridization, and AI hype cycles - are brief and buried in extended off-topic conversation, delivering an extremely low ratio of actionable insight per minute.
“the cluster was cheap but like the people to maintain it would cost a lot of money and it was just like constant babysitting and Monkeying with things to keep the system running”
“for many applications, it will turn out still to be more, much more economical to use more traditional classical statistical NLP methods to analyze data”
The handful of substantive claims - Snowflake IPO as catalyst for the modern data stack hype cycle, AI entering the trough of disillusionment, classical NLP being cheaper than LLMs - are all widely circulated takes in the data community, not contrarian or first-principles arguments. No genuinely fresh framing appears.
“recall the, I mean from my perspective, the modern data stack really got kicked off by the Snowflake IPO”
“I think we're heading a bit into the trough of disillusionment with this technology”

A small number of concrete anchors exist - Snowflake's IPO date and approximate share price, the book's publication date, the show's origin date - but these are biographical trivia rather than evidence supporting analytical claims. No revenue figures, customer metrics, or rigorous data underpin any of the arguments made.
“Snowflake IPO is September 2020 and biggest tech IPO of all time as far as I know”
“even if you did the IPO, even I think at 120 per share, I believe it was. Yeah, you're uh, ain't doing well”
There is no interviewing craft on display; the episode is a string of social drop-in cameos where guests offer praise and the hosts respond warmly. Questions are vague and open-ended with zero follow-up or pushback, and the format structurally prevents any substantive exchange from developing.
“Walk us through, you know, kind of the early days. Like, what was, uh, what was it like for you to. To do a podcast?”
“What do you think is the next story going into 2025 and 2026?”
